There were anywhere from 40 to 62 prisoners in the Glenrowan Inn, summoned there by Ned Kelly 
and his gang. At various times people were held at the Inn and the stationmaster's house, with most eventually 
being kept in the Inn. Once Bracken was taken prisoner, everyone was kept in the Inn. Some were sympathisers 
and others were simply caught up in what was going on. Below is a smattering of names of some who witnessed 
history. (this list includes all prisoners no matter where they were held. Including some who stayed home!)

... The terrified Mrs. Stanistreet and her children were left at home but are still included as prisoners
(some prisoners were earlier held at Stanistreets and watched by Steve Hart).  
Mrs. Bracken and her two year old son Richard were also left at home.

....Mrs. Margaret Reardon was listed as Mary in McMenomy (Ned Kelly) and Margaret by The Royal 
Commission, Jones (A Short Life) & Clune (Ned Kelly's Last Stand). 
The accurate full name appears to be Margaret Mary Reardon.
